On June 12, 2012, Stewart Muglich will be speaking at "Doing Business in Foreign Jurisdictions", a seminar jointly-hosted by the BC Securities Commissions and Institute of Chartered Accountants of BC. He will be discussing risk exposures for foreign private issuers doing business in the U.S., particularly in relation to Dodd-Frank and the Foreign Corrupt Practices Acts.
